Plowden, David. Cape May to Montauk by David Plowden. Untitled (Friends of Photography) critical look at industrial declineViking, 1973. 1st edition. 127 pages. Photos in color by David Plowden with text by Nelson P. Falorp. Includes the natural beauty of the Jersey Shore, Staten Island, New York Harbor, Long Island, Fire Island, East Hampton, etc. Fine with slightly chipped dust jacket. Summary: Cape May to Montauk (published by The Viking Press A Studio Book in 1973) is a poignant visual and textual exploration of the Mid Atlantic and southern New England coastlines.
